Light, temperature and humidity all alter the way colours are printed and printers react and colours are viewed.. Monitors you could probably get away with less, but a simple power off/on of a monitor and the colours change, even if it is just .005%, it's still a change.

It's just safer, that way when client A thinks their monitor is calibrated, and I give them a proof and they complain about colours, I ask them what they are profiled too... 99% of the time they are just like "wtf?" Trying to maintain a 6 coulr printer to pantone, sRGB and hexachrome as closely as is physically possible is damn damn hard.
